(KSL News) Searchers in three Utah counties are looking for a Colorado Woman missing in a rugged area of eastern Utah.

Fifty-four-year-old Rose Backhaus was last seen checking out of a Moab motel on November 16th and hasn't been heard from since.

Yesterday, Emery County authorities found her SUV in Goblin Valley State Park.

Because no one knows where she may be, searches also are underway in Grand and San Juan counties.

Her family says Backhaus is an avid hiker who has hiked alone before, but they say it's not like her to not check in with them.
